Bengaluru — India’s startup ecosystem has entered a new phase, marked by resilience, sustainability, and scale. At TechSparks 2025, YourStory unveiled its annual Tech30 list, spotlighting 30 startups chosen from over 2,000 applications. These ventures are not chasing valuations alone; they are solving hard problems in energy, AI, biotech, and robotics with homegrown technology that rivals global standards.
Among the highlights is Aeronero Solutions, which generates clean drinking water directly from air using atmospheric water generation technology. Its modular systems can produce up to 50,000 liters per day at just Rs 4 per liter—or zero when powered by solar energy. Cosmoserve Space is tackling orbital safety with autonomous robotic spacecraft designed to clean up space debris, a challenge that threatens global connectivity.
Healthcare innovation is equally prominent. Articulus Surgical develops affordable surgical robotics for minimally invasive procedures, while NeuroDiscovery AI builds platforms to analyze neurological data, offering doctors real‑time insights. Humn Health leverages smartphone cameras as continuous health sensors, focusing initially on maternal health conditions such as gestational diabetes and preeclampsia.
AI‑driven solutions dominate the list. Bolna AI creates multilingual voice agents for recruitment and logistics, Genloop enables enterprises to query structured data with natural language, and Wizr AI offers no‑code platforms to deploy AI agents safely. Meanwhile, Pavakah Energy introduces thin‑film coatings that turn any surface into a solar panel, cooling rooftops while generating electricity.
